Abstract

PURPOSE:To prevent contamination in a magnetic disk device by removing dust stuck on components, especially, dust which cannot be removed even after cleaning previous to assembly and dust which is generated at the time of driving. CONSTITUTION:A magnetic disk 1 rotated by a spindle 2, a magnetic head 5 records/reproduced in/from the magnetic disk 1 and a carriage 3 moves/ positions the magnetic head 5 are supported and included in a base plate 4 formed in a case-shape. Also, an electrostatic filter 7 is formed on the inner wall of the base plate 4 and dust left at the time of assembly and dust which detaches from the surface of members in the magnetic disk device and files in the device are absorbed by the electrostatic filter 7 then the amount of the dust is reduced.
